Output e77feafa6ed634b27ad5fcd662890548fec551a2853a3fd55abc84ad97f7a03e:1

value
601000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b68a2283c0029064c034cc76549d9ca08776e3 OP_EQUAL
address
3NMmJyEncFa96ggd7GU42j8Zbh7oZoq1JN
transaction
e77feafa6ed634b27ad5fcd662890548fec551a2853a3fd55abc84ad97f7a03e
spent
true